Enzo Anselmo Giuseppe Maria Ferrari Cavaliere di Gran Croce OMRI [1] (/ f ə ˈ r ɑːr i /; Italian: [ˈɛntso anˈsɛlmo ferˈraːri]; 18 February 1898 [2] – 14 August 1988) was an Italian motor racing driver and entrepreneur, the founder of the Scuderia Ferrari Grand Prix motor racing team, and subsequently of the Ferrari automobile marque.
Museo Casa Enzo Ferrari (also known as Museo Enzo Ferrari) is a museum in Modena focused on the life and work of Enzo Ferrari, the founder of the Ferrari sports car marque. . The film Ferrari (2023), directed by Michael Mann and written by Troy Kennedy Martin, follows the personal and professional struggles of Enzo Ferrari, the Italian founder of the car manufacturer Ferrari, during the summer of 1957 as Scuderia Ferrari prepares to compete in the 1957 Mille Miglia.
